About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Preparation of health & wellness assessment and recommendations
- Planning, coordinating and implementing the care plan for each client
- Supervise recommendations from the assessment and Care Management meetings
- Coordinate client’s physician, dental and other medical appointments
- Supervise medical issues including medications and be present at doctor visits
- Communicate with and support family members and other responsible parties
- Prepare weekly schedules of planned and completed activities - Chart all pertinent client information
- Advocacy; obtain restraining orders, testify in circuit court and at the State’s attorney level, testify as an expert witness
- Must have reliable transportation to and from the client’s residence
- Take potential client intake calls to determine needs, align them with appropriate services and complete paperwork to start services.
- Attract referrals and inquiries to build care management services.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Masters in Social Work or RN, CMC Preferred
- Eligible for certification by the National Academy of Certified Care Managers
- Require at least 5 years of RN experience in eldercare, LPN must have at least 10 years of experience in eldercare
- All must have 2 years of experience in Care Management, Social Work or Hospice is preferred.
- Strong written and oral communication skills.
- Experience working with individuals with Alzheimer's disease or forms of dementia.
- Experience with Jewel Code Care Complete or similar Care Management Programs preferred
